The Body Doesn't Heal Without Sleep


When we sleep, our bodies go into repair service mode. Muscles recoup, cells regenerate, and our body immune system reinforces. It's a time when the body detoxifies and recovers. But when sleep is stopped or when it's consistently low quality, this entire process is disrupted.


In time, an absence of correct rest can bring about weakened resistance, making you extra at risk to health problems. Even wounds heal extra slowly when you're sleep-deprived. Persistent bad sleep has also been linked to a higher threat of creating long-term health conditions like heart problem, diabetic issues, and hypertension.


A good night's remainder isn't a high-end-- it's a necessity for the body to function appropriately.

Psychological Resilience Depends on Quality Rest


Ever before see exactly how your patience frays after a negative evening's rest? That's no coincidence. Rest and feelings are deeply linked.


When you're well-rested, you're better geared up to regulate your emotions and reply to stressful scenarios. Without rest, little inconveniences can feel overwhelming. This takes place because the brain's emotional center comes to be over active, while the region in charge of abstract thought slows down.


State of mind swings, irritation, stress and anxiety, and also depressive episodes can all be linked to poor rest. Emotional stability depends on obtaining consistent, deep rest. And if interrupted rest comes to be a pattern, it may be time to check out if a much deeper problem is at play.

Hormone Imbalance and Weight Gain


Yes, rest affects your weight-- and not just because you're too tired to hit the gym.


Sleep plays a major function in regulating the hormonal agents that regulate hunger and metabolic rate. When you're sleep-deprived, your body produces more ghrelin (the hunger hormonal agent) and less leptin (the hormonal agent that makes you feel full). This inequality commonly leads to boosted appetite and junk food selections.


Additionally, chronic inadequate rest can disrupt insulin level of sensitivity, raising the risk of type 2 diabetes mellitus. Your body's ability to regulate blood glucose counts greatly on rest, making it important for total metabolic wellness.
